WebAs in Nevada state court, people who do not report to jury duty in Nevada federal court will be summoned to appear at a show cause hearing. If they fail to show up or give a good excuse for missing jury duty, the judge may order: up to $1,000 in fines, and/or; up to three (3) days in jail, and/or; community service 3; 3. The juror may be required to appear before a judge to show adequate cause for their absence from jury duty and may be held in contempt of court under the Jury Selection Act (18 U.S.C. 1866 ... WebDec 5, 2024 · 5) not have been convicted of a felony What happens if a juror does not report for jury service? Jury duty, like paying taxes, is mandatory. Skipping jury duty can result in civil or criminal penalties. In addition, anyone who skips jury service will be assigned a new date for future jury service.

WebIf you don't give a good enough reason for missing jury duty in Colorado, you will be penalized in at least one of these ways: A fine of up to $1,000 Community service Up to three days in jail A combination of at least two of them
